相关疑难解决方法(0)

使用列num_rows创建一个视图 - MySQL

我需要创建一个视图,其中有一个名为row_num的列,它将插入行号,就像普通表中的自动增量一样.

假设我有这个普通表:

| country | name | age | price |
--------------------------------
| US      | john | 22  | 20    |
| France  | Anne | 10  | 15    |
| Sweden  | Alex | 49  | 10    |
Run Code Online (Sandbox Code Playgroud)

等等...

我想创建的视图是:

    | country | name | price | row_num |
    ------------------------------------
    | US      | john |  20   |    1    |
    | France  | Anne |  10   |    2    |
    | Sweden  | Alex |  5    |    3    |
Run Code Online (Sandbox Code Playgroud)

等等...

我可以用一个select生成row_num: …

mysql views

7
推荐指数
2
解决办法
2万
查看次数

标签 统计

mysql ×1

views ×1